Breaking Down Barriers to Global Expansion
A significant advantage of e-commerce development is the ability to break down traditional barriers that hinder international trade. Small businesses no longer need to invest in physical infrastructure to access foreign markets. E-commerce platforms provide integrated solutions to handle complex logistics like currency conversions, language barriers, and international shipping.
How e-commerce removes barriers to global expansion:
-
Currency Conversion & Language Support: E-commerce platforms typically offer tools that convert currencies and translate websites, making it easier for customers worldwide to understand the offer and make purchases.
-
International Shipping & Payments: Integrated shipping calculators, along with third-party logistics providers and digital wallets, simplify international transactions and logistics.
-
Global Accessibility: With localized content, including region-specific promotions and payment methods, small businesses can offer a seamless experience to customers across the globe.

Optimized Supply Chain and Logistics Management for Global Operations
E-commerce development has revolutionized the way small businesses manage their supply chain and logistics. Integration with third-party logistics providers, inventory management systems, and dropshipping services enables small businesses to handle complex global operations without significant investments.
Key supply chain and logistics benefits for small businesses:
-
Third-Party Logistics (3PL) Partnerships: Small businesses can partner with 3PL companies to manage warehousing, shipping, and returns, enabling them to reach international customers without setting up physical locations in other countries.
-
Virtual Inventory: E-commerce platforms enable businesses to maintain virtual inventory, making it easier to stock products across multiple locations globally.
-
Reduced Overhead Costs: The ability to dropship and automate inventory management reduces the need for costly infrastructure, allowing businesses to test new markets without significant financial risk.
Building Trust and Credibility in Global Markets
For small businesses, earning the trust of international customers is crucial. E-commerce platforms help build credibility with features like secure payment gateways, SSL certificates, and customer review systems.
How to build trust and credibility globally:
-
Secure Payment Solutions: Payment gateways like PayPal, Stripe, and credit card processing systems ensure that transactions are safe and secure.
-
Customer Reviews & Ratings: Reviews and ratings on e-commerce platforms provide social proof, which is essential for establishing credibility, especially in unfamiliar markets.
-
Region-Specific Features: By offering local currency, language, and culturally relevant content, small businesses demonstrate commitment to serving international customers.
